Managed Hosting vs VPS Hosting: Which Is Better for Performance?

Choosing between Managed Hosting vs VPS Hosting: Which Is Better for Performance? depends on more than raw server power. The right option for your site will depend on traffic patterns, technical skill, database activity, caching needs, and how much control you want over the environment.

For blogs, WordPress sites, WooCommerce stores, and agency projects, hosting can influence server response time, uptime, security, and scalability. But hosting is only one part of performance: themes, plugins, images, scripts, and third-party services can also slow a website down.

What Managed Hosting and VPS Hosting Actually Mean

Managed hosting means the provider takes care of much of the technical maintenance for you. That may include server updates, security patching, monitoring, backups, and some level of optimisation support. The exact scope varies by provider, so it is worth checking what is included before you rely on it.

VPS hosting, or Virtual Private Server hosting, gives you a private slice of a physical server with dedicated resource allocations such as CPU, memory, and storage. You usually get more control than on shared hosting, but you are also responsible for more administration unless you choose a managed VPS plan.

Neither option is automatically faster for every site. A managed plan can perform very well if it is tuned for your platform, while a VPS can be excellent if it is configured properly and not overloaded. The key question is how much control, support, and maintenance responsibility you want alongside performance.

Performance Differences That Matter Most

From a website speed perspective, the most important factors are consistent resources, low server response time, and the ability to cope with traffic spikes. Managed hosting often aims to reduce the amount of work you need to do, while VPS hosting gives you more direct control over server settings, caching layers, and software versions.

That extra control can help experienced users optimise PHP settings, database performance, and object caching. However, it can also create problems if the server is misconfigured, not updated, or sized too small for the workload. In that case, raw control does not translate into better performance.

If your site runs on WordPress, the difference may show up in how well the host handles caching, automatic updates, and resource-heavy plugins. For WooCommerce and other ecommerce sites, the ability to preserve speed during peak activity matters because cart, checkout, and account pages are more dynamic than standard pages.

When Managed Hosting Is the Better Fit

Managed hosting is often the more practical choice for website owners who want strong performance without spending hours on server administration. It can suit bloggers, small businesses, agencies managing multiple client sites, and teams that prefer support over technical tuning.

This option is especially useful if you want help with backups, security updates, staging environments, or platform-specific maintenance. For example, a managed WordPress host may provide tooling that simplifies caching and updates, but you should still confirm how it handles plugin conflicts, database growth, and restore procedures.

Managed hosting can also reduce the risk of avoidable mistakes. Poorly configured caching, outdated software, or weak security settings can all affect speed and reliability. If you are not comfortable managing those tasks, a managed plan may deliver more stable real-world performance even if a VPS offers greater theoretical control.

When VPS Hosting Makes More Sense

VPS hosting is often a better fit for developers, technical site owners, SaaS projects, and websites that need custom software or specialised server settings. If you need to install specific services, adjust server-level caching, or tune the environment for a demanding application, a VPS can be a strong option.

It also gives you more room to scale in a controlled way. As traffic, concurrent users, storage needs, or database activity increase, you can often upgrade resources more predictably than you could on shared hosting. That said, a VPS only performs as well as its configuration and ongoing maintenance allow.

For performance-focused users, it is worth understanding the difference between shared hosting, VPS hosting, cloud hosting, and dedicated hosting. Shared hosting usually offers the least control and the most resource sharing. Dedicated hosting gives the most isolated hardware resources. Cloud hosting can offer flexibility and scaling. VPS sits in the middle for many websites, but the best choice depends on workload and budget rather than labels alone.

How Hosting Affects Real Website Speed

Hosting can influence page speed, but it rarely acts alone. A slow theme, excessive plugins, large images, heavy JavaScript, web fonts, or too many third-party scripts can create delays even on a good server. Likewise, unoptimised databases and too many redirects can increase load time regardless of hosting type.

Caching can make a major difference when it is configured correctly. Browser caching stores assets on a visitor’s device, page caching serves prebuilt pages, object caching can reduce repeated database work, and CDN caching can deliver static files from locations closer to users. A content delivery network, or CDN, helps with distance and latency, but it will not fix poor code or overloaded database queries on the origin server.

For background reading on performance concepts, Google’s Core Web Vitals guidance is useful. Largest Contentful Paint measures loading speed for the main visible content, Interaction to Next Paint reflects responsiveness, and Cumulative Layout Shift tracks visual stability. These metrics matter, but they are only part of the user experience.

What to Check Before You Choose

Before moving to managed hosting or a VPS, compare the factors that affect day-to-day performance rather than just the plan name. Ask how resources are allocated, what support is included, whether backups are independent and restorable, and how the provider handles monitoring, security, and scaling.

  • Expected traffic and peak concurrent users
  • WordPress, WooCommerce, or custom application requirements
  • Need for staging, backups, and restore testing
  • Ability to manage updates, security, and caching
  • Location of your audience and data-centre region
  • Need for database tuning, object caching, or CDN support

If you are planning a migration, back up the site first, verify DNS settings, test the migrated site thoroughly, and monitor it after launch. A host change can improve stability, but it can also expose hidden issues such as broken redirects, missing files, or cache conflicts if the move is rushed.

Testing, Monitoring, and Common Mistakes

Performance test results can vary depending on location, device, connection speed, cache state, and the testing tool. Laboratory tests such as Lighthouse or PageSpeed Insights can help identify bottlenecks, while field data reflects how real visitors experience the site over time. A high score in a test is useful, but it does not guarantee that all users will have the same experience.

When diagnosing slow performance, compare one change at a time. For instance, test image compression separately from caching changes, and review whether the database, server response time, or front-end assets are the main issue. Uptime monitoring is also valuable because it helps you spot outages and patterns, even though it cannot prevent every incident.

Common mistakes include choosing a plan that is too small, assuming hosting is the only problem, enabling conflicting optimisation plugins, or using full-page caching on dynamic pages without exclusions. Frequently Asked Questions

Is managed hosting faster than VPS hosting?

Not always. Managed hosting can be faster for some sites because it is set up and maintained by specialists, but a well-configured VPS can outperform it for certain workloads. The real result depends on resources, configuration, and website complexity.

Does VPS hosting improve Core Web Vitals automatically?

No. Better server resources may help with loading and responsiveness, but Core Web Vitals also depend on front-end assets, theme quality, images, scripts, and caching. Hosting is only one part of the picture.

Is managed hosting better for WordPress and WooCommerce?

It can be, especially if you want updates, backups, monitoring, and platform-specific support handled for you. However, a VPS may be the right choice if you need custom tuning or have the skills to manage the server properly.

Should I switch hosting if my site is slow?

Only after checking other causes first. Slow plugins, large images, database inefficiencies, bad caching, and third-party scripts can all cause delays. If your current host is also limiting resources or response time, then a move may be worth considering.
